Re: Can't animate the drift color independently
It's a bit easier now to propose a solution. Color Points could help. Although it would not be applied to a stroke but rather on a ring, you may still achieve the desired effect. Unlike Color Drift, changes on CP can be animated. As in the example, you might need additional points for fine gradation...
